HB 1478 Missouri House · 2025 Regular Session

Modifies provisions relating to the Missouri working family tax credit act and makes the tax credit refundable

HB 1478 modifies Missouri's Working Family Tax Credit Act to make the state tax credit refundable starting in 2026. The bill provides eligible Missouri residents - those who qualify for the federal Earned Income Tax Credit (EITC) and file as single, head of household, widowed, or married filing jointly - with a state credit equal to 10% to 20% of their federal EITC amount (capped at 20%). The credit becomes refundable after 2025, meaning excess credit value will be paid as cash refunds instead of being lost. The Missouri Department of Revenue must proactively notify eligible taxpayers who didn’t claim the credit and report annual usage statistics.
